Ingredients

  • 2 (10.75 ounce) cans condensed cream of chicken soup
  • 1 (15 ounce) can chicken broth
  • 1 ½ cups chopped cooked turkey, or more to taste
  • 1 cup chopped potatoes, or more to taste
  • 1 cup chopped carrots, or more to taste
  • ½ onion, chopped
  • 2 tablespoons butter
  • 1 pinch garlic powder
  • 1 pinch poultry seasoning
  • ½ (10 ounce) can refrigerated buttermilk biscuit dough (such as Pillsbury Grands!®), cut into squares

Information

  • Prep Time: 10 mins
  • Cook Time: 4 hrs
  • Total Time: 4 hrs 10 mins
  • Servings: 4

  • Mix cream of chicken soup, chicken broth, chopped cooked turkey, potatoes, carrots, onion, butter, garlic powder, and poultry seasoning together in a slow cooker.
  • Cook on High for 3 hours.
  • Stir soup, then arrange biscuits on top. Continue cooking until biscuits are cooked through, about 1 more hour.
  • Nutrition

    449 cal.

    • Total Fat: 22g
    • Saturated Fat: 8g
    • Cholesterol: 70mg
    • Sodium: 1961mg
    • Total Carbohydrate: 38g
    • Dietary Fiber: 2g
    • Total Sugars: 7g
    • Protein: 23g
    • Vitamin C: 11mg
    • Calcium: 76mg
    • Iron: 4mg
    • Potassium: 584mg
